I believe some people install calibre portable along with their library onto their 'Dropbox Drive' - then wherever they are they can access the same library with the same calibre (version, settings, plug-ins etc)

From memory DoctorOhh a long time user of calibre and one of the 'senior' moderators of the calibre forum does this - I'm sure he wont mind if you send a PM and get him to chime in.

I have tried it, but my alternate location is on the end of a slow and unreliable satellite link, so whilst it worked, it wasn't viable at 256Kbs, and there's a traffic quota on the sat link. Worked fine on higher speed links (10Mps+) though.

Also avoids the issue of leaving computers turned on - Dropbox is more or less always on.
